China is the world largest producer of aluminum extrusions, with an industrial ecosystem that spans raw material processing, profile fabrication, hardware manufacturing, and glass production all concentrated in regions like Guangdong. This vertical integration means that a well-run sliding door factory in China can offer product quality that rivals or exceeds European brands, at a significantly more competitive price point. The key is identifying manufacturers that invest in advanced production technology, use premium-grade materials, and adhere to international building standards rather than those competing purely on price.

The SL155 is ALPES premium offering, designed for projects where performance cannot be compromised. With a main load-bearing profile thickness of 2.2mm exceeding the latest national standard and a single-panel double-rail self-balancing pulley system with 20 wheels supporting up to 400kg, this door is built for large-scale openings. A single sash can reach 2800mm in width and 2600mm in height, yielding an opening area of up to 7.5m². The passive check valve drainage system accelerates water removal while preventing backflow, and the integrated flush-mount handle design delivers a sleek, seamless aesthetic. The dual-matrix eight-layer sealing system ensures all-weather waterproofing and sound insulation.
The SL112/167 series offers exceptional flexibility with its frame-enclosing-sash structural design. Available in single-track (112mm), two-track (112mm), and three-track (167mm) configurations, it adapts to diverse architectural layouts. The 45mm high-drop bottom track provides instant drainage, and an optional 85mm high water barrier adds extra protection for flood-prone areas. With single-sash driving capacity up to 220kg and 24A insulated glass, this series balances robust engineering with practical versatility. Optional add-ons include glass railings, inward-opening mesh screens, and rolling mesh systems.
Both the 96mm and 75mm sash variants of the SL126/182 series feature locally reinforced profiles thickened to 3.0mm in critical zones for superior wind pressure resistance. The patented eave-style waterproof design and bottom-track water-blocking edge work together to keep interiors dry even in heavy rain. The 75mm variant takes the aesthetic lead with an ultra-slim central interlock for panoramic views, while the 96mm variant offers a seamless pressure-line-free frame surface. Both support lift-sliding operation and accommodate argon-filled insulating glass for top-tier thermal performance.
When evaluating potential manufacturers, here are the five factors that separate premium suppliers from the rest:
1. Aluminum Grade and Profile Thickness. Premium manufacturers use 6060-T66 aluminum alloy a high-precision extrusion grade with excellent structural rigidity and corrosion resistance. Profile thickness should range from 1.8mm to 2.5mm depending on the door size and application. Anything below 1.8mm signals cost-cutting at the expense of long-term durability.
2. Thermal Break System. The thermal break is the heart of an energy-efficient sliding door. Look for PA66GF25 polyamide strips with multi-chamber designs, which physically separate the interior and exterior aluminum frames to prevent heat transfer. ALPES dual-matrix eight-layer sealing system incorporating extended, composite, welded, threaded, and dense sealing strips demonstrates the level of engineering that separates a high-performance door from a basic one.
3. Hardware Partnerships. The hardware determines how a door feels and how long it lasts. Premium manufacturers partner with established German brands such as ROTO, Winkhaus, and Wehag. ROTO transmission boxes and anti-pry lock points, Winkhaus 169-year engineering heritage, and CMECH handles tested to 30,000 cycles are all indicators of a supplier that refuses to compromise on components.
4. Manufacturing Processes. Look for full glue-injection structural bonding (not just mechanical fastening), seamless welded corner seals, and precision roller-pressing for mesh screens. These processes directly impact the door airtightness, water tightness, and long-term structural stability.
